Rocket-To-The-Moon said:
Is there an easy way to migrate the current one to this new one?
The easiest way may be for brmj to dump the contents of his wiki's underlying database to a text file, email that to Zvan and then have Zvan restore those values into his database – this would copy across all existing pages, their histories, user accounts, etc.
Of course, it may not be necessary to do things so manually. There may be Mediawiki migration tools out there which are more reliable than this.
